Keep in mind with this information that it is exclusive to the modification programs that had to be obtained from your Mortgage Servicer (such as Wells Fargo or whomever you made mortgage payments to). The major caveat with this program is that the homeowner had to already be late on their mortgage to qualify which gave some homeowners who couldn’t find alternatives to refinance a precarious choice at best. Don’t refinance or damage your credit by letting your payment become late to qualify.
This is different than the refinance programs that the Obama administration put together to be offered through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ac (the options I touched on a few weeks back) and although it did help a great deal of homeowners, it also handcuffed many homeowners into damaging their credit as the only option.
